Your car gets one pool of light and the room around it to breathe. Generous spacing means no door dings, no shuffling other cars to reach yours, and never a lift stacked overhead. A fitted cover goes on the day you arrive.
Every week, someone walks the floor slowly and stops at your car. The battery tender gets a look. Tire pressures get checked and set. The cradles keep the rubber from taking a set while the car sits.
Then the slow walk-around: a drip on the concrete, a low tire, a cover that has shifted. Small things, caught early, before they become a phone call you did not want. That is collector car care in Tennessee the way an owner would do it, if the owner had the time.
